-/**
- * A listener being notified of events from the repository system. In general, the system sends events upon termination
- * of an operation like {@link #artifactResolved(RepositoryEvent)} regardless whether it succeeded or failed so
- * listeners need to inspect the event details carefully. Also, the listener may be called from an arbitrary thread.
- * <em>Note:</em> Implementors are strongly advised to inherit from {@link AbstractRepositoryListener} instead of
- * directly implementing this interface.
- *
- * @see org.eclipse.aether.RepositorySystemSession#getRepositoryListener()
- * @see org.eclipse.aether.transfer.TransferListener
- * @noimplement This interface is not intended to be implemented by clients.
- * @noextend This interface is not intended to be extended by clients.
- */
-public interface RepositoryListener
-{
-
- /**
- * Notifies the listener of a syntactically or semantically invalid artifact descriptor.
- * {@link RepositoryEvent#getArtifact()} indicates the artifact whose descriptor is invalid and
- * {@link RepositoryEvent#getExceptions()} carries the encountered errors. Depending on the session's
- * {@link org.eclipse.aether.resolution.ArtifactDescriptorPolicy}, the underlying repository operation might abort
- * with an exception or ignore the invalid descriptor.
- *
- * @param event The event details, must not be {@code null}.
- */
- void artifactDescriptorInvalid( RepositoryEvent event );
-
- /**
- * Notifies the listener of a missing artifact descriptor. {@link RepositoryEvent#getArtifact()} indicates the
- * artifact whose descriptor is missing. Depending on the session's
- * {@link org.eclipse.aether.resolution.ArtifactDescriptorPolicy}, the underlying repository operation might abort
- * with an exception or ignore the missing descriptor.
- *
- * @param event The event details, must not be {@code null}.
- */
- void artifactDescriptorMissing( RepositoryEvent event );
-
- /**
- * Notifies the listener of syntactically or semantically invalid metadata. {@link RepositoryEvent#getMetadata()}
- * indicates the invalid metadata and {@link RepositoryEvent#getExceptions()} carries the encountered errors. The
- * underlying repository operation might still succeed, depending on whether the metadata in question is actually
- * needed to carry out the resolution process.
- *
- * @param event The event details, must not be {@code null}.
- */
- void metadataInvalid( RepositoryEvent event );
-
- /**
- * Notifies the listener of an artifact that is about to be resolved. {@link RepositoryEvent#getArtifact()} denotes
- * the artifact in question. Unlike the {@link #artifactDownloading(RepositoryEvent)} event, this event is fired
- * regardless whether the artifact already exists locally or not.
- *
- * @param event The event details, must not be {@code null}.
- */
- void artifactResolving( RepositoryEvent event );
